Itinerary
We'll pick you up from your hotel or villa in Krabi Town, Tub Kaek or Klong Muang between 11:30 - 12:00.
If you are staying in Ao Nang, we'll pick you up between 12:00 - 12:30. From here, we head to Nopparat Thara Pier.
Depending on the boat option you selected and booked for, we'll board either the longtail boat or speedboat at the pier. Put on your life vest and we head off to the Hong Islands from here. If you booked the longtail boat, the ride takes around 40 minutes to the first island. If you booked the speedboat, the ride takes about 20 minutes.
The first stop is Railay, for our customers who are staying here. The boat docks at the meeting point between 12:00 - 12:30.
We visit Hong Island, one of the most beautiful islands close to Ao Nang. It's located in between towering limestone cliffs and is a great place to relax or go swimming.
If you're up for it; you can visit the Hong Island 360-degree viewpoint (419 steps in total). It's quite a walk up and only suitable if you're in good health. The views at the top are worth it though: you'll get a 360-degree view of the islands here.
Through a narrow passage we enter Hong Lagoon. A magical place totally surrounded by limestone cliffs. The water looks emerald green here. A great photo opportunity!
This is the famous tree-filled beach with a swing. From here you have a nice view at neighbouring islands. Depending on the sea and tide conditions, we'll have dinner here or at Pakbia Island.
This rocky island connects to other islands by a beautiful white sandy beach. We have dinner here or at Lao Lading, depending on the sea and tide conditions. Enjoy a tasty BBQ buffet on the beach.
When the sun sets, it's time to head back to a spot close to Ao Nang where you can go swimming with plankton. These little animals light up in the dark, which is a once in a lifetime experience! Swim with plankton that look like thousands of bright blue dots. Please note that the availability depends on tidal and seasonal changes.
At around 18:30, it's time to board the boats one last time to head back to the pier. If you are staying near Railay, the boat will drop you off there.
Our drivers are waiting at the pier to bring you back to your hotel for the return transfer. The Hong Island sunset tour ends here!

For dinner we will serve a mini Thai-style BBQ buffet on the beach. You can enjoy fresh Thai food, meat or seafood. We have vegetarian and halal options available.
Yes you can, our boat will be docking at the meeting point on Railay between 12:00 - 12:30. At the end of the trip we will drop you off at Railay as well.
The longtail boat takes longer to get to the Hong Islands. Travel times are almost double, which means there is less time to spend at the different stops. The speedboat gets there faster but is a more expensive way of traveling.
Yes, it is totally safe. They are minuscule animals and swimming with them feels a bit weird at the start. It can give you a bit of a rash sensation on your skin, but that will be gone the moment you get out of the water. The stunning views of the bright blue colors is absolutely worth it.
Yes, young children (2-3 years) are welcome to join this tour. Please note that it may be difficult for very small children to get in and out of the longtail boat, as well as for elderly persons. Unfortunately, we do not recommend nor accept very young children (0-1 years) to join.
The Hong Island sunset tour will run during rainy days if the water is calm enough. If that is not the case, we will reschedule the trip for a calmer day or refund you the deposit (if any).
